Output de50bfba76789769396495377bc97d850736106d88fa48e36eec1355b306997a:0

value
3000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 015e30cd40e38a222256b2d5116bec66f377d159 OP_EQUALVERIFY OP_CHECKSIG
address
18EWfxVcFt3zX3UzRwbLdeSNgtRPnHW4c
transaction
de50bfba76789769396495377bc97d850736106d88fa48e36eec1355b306997a
confirmations
518309
spent
true